The gimmick with the Soul of Cryogen is that a sacrifice of mobility is needed in order to reap its damage bonus, since it counts as wings so no other wings can be used with it.
All's I'm saying is that the sacrifice of mobility needed to make use of the Soul of Cryogen is too great compared to the dodging capabilities late-game wing accessories grant, which are essential in expert mode.

This is why I am suggesting that the Soul of Cryogen should instead count as boots, barring all other boot accessories from being used. With this change, a sacrifice of mobility is still required to use it, as boots are valuable for boss fights and simple convenience. However, using the Soul of Cryogen with this change won't completely ruin your much needed mobility because you will still be able to use wings.
